Thread design

Thread design are a studio based in Beijing, their location fits in well with my plans to teach in China. They produce quite a broad range of design and are quite a large studio, which is quite different to the design studios that I am normally attracted to. A lot of their work is quite corporate looking, but their are a few projects that appeal to my tastes as well.

I have found a studio that I am really interested in the look of in Singapore. They produce work in both English and Chinese which is what initially appealed to me, but they also produce a lot of publications and print based design work. 




One of my favourite projects of theirs is a calendar designed to 'save paper'. They asked twelve individuals, all from different creative disciplines to create an object using paper, in order to elevate its status.

Thanks to digital proliferation, paper's numerous variants and breeds are dying out, leaving only the dull A4 copier paper, most commonly found in offices.
